The 15th Annual Long Island Smart Growth Summit, will be held on Friday, December 2nd from 8am-4pm at the Crest Hollow Country Club. Registration form and sponsorship information are below.

Last year's event drew over 1,000 civic, chambers, developers, environmentalists, design professionals, business leaders, young people and over 70 federal, state, county, town and village elected officials from Long Island and the region.  Over the last five years we have had 1000-1200 in attendance.

The Smart Growth Movement is busy approving 12,000 units of transit oriented development, revitalization programs in over 50 Long Island downtowns, 40 traffic calming projects, new Main Street office space, lively restaurants/bars nightlife, and countless events featuring the arts, culture and live music.  Recent increased Federal, State and County infrastructure investments in our sewers, rails, buses and roadways have also been critical to the success of the redevelopment projects.

The Summit is the event where we share ideas, network on projects, financing, regulations and spotlight successes while managing roadblocks.

The 15th Annual Long Island Smart Growth Summit will feature networking, a trade show, nearly 20 workshops, a youth summit and plenary sessions on regional and local issues facing mixed-use development.
